TP钱包转不出钱:从签名、网络与稳定币流转的“隐形卡点”排查到智能资产追踪

当你在TP钱包里按下“转账”却发现余额像被按住一样无法出去,问题往往不止表面那一句“转账失败”。更像是一场被拆散在链上多个环节的对照赛:先是地址与公钥体系是否匹配,再到稳定币合约是否按预期执行,最后才轮到网络拥堵、手续费与节点响应把事情推向“卡住”。

第一步要检查的是“签名与授权”是否成立。TP钱包发起交易本质上是对交易数据进行签名;如果你切换过助记词/导入方式、或曾进行过权限授权(尤其是给某些DApp或代币合约授权),常见现象是:钱包界面显示可用余额,但链上验证拒绝,交易回执迟迟不生成或直接失败。此时重点不是余额少了,而是“交易意图”在链上没有通过验证。建议你回到转账详情页,核对接收地址是否正确、金额是否精确到稳定币的小数位、以及Gas/手续费是否设定合理。很多稳定币的最小单位很敏感,少一位就可能导致合约校验失败。

第二步看“网络与手续费”是否引发延迟甚至超时。链上状态会随时间变化:同一笔交易在高峰期可能需要更高的手续费才能被打包。你可能已经支付了手续费,但节点未及时打包,钱包就会表现为“转不出”。这类问题通常伴随确认状态停留在某个阶段,甚至出现交易哈希但没有回执。解决思路是:尝试更换网络节点、适度提高手续费或等待一段时间后重试。

第三步要把焦点放到“稳定币合约执行”上。USDT/USDC等稳定币是合约资产,转账不是简单余额减加,而是合约方法调用。若接收方地址处于合约无法识别的状态、或接收链/代币类型不一致(例如把某链上的资产当作另一链的同名代币来转),合约会拒绝执行。你会看到余额在钱包里存在,但链上没有发生转移。

第四步是“智能资产追踪”的必要性:不要只盯余额数字,要追踪代币在链上的流转轨迹。很多人以为钱包余额就是链上余额的镜像,但在不同网络、不同代币合约、或跨链桥缓存未完成时,钱包可能展示“本地可见”,却无法立刻完成链上出账。你可以通过交易浏览器核对代币合约地址、最新区块高度与转账事件,确认到底卡在“发起阶段”还是“执行阶段”。

最后谈一个常被忽略的现实:公钥与地址格式并非总是你想象的那样“自动就能通”。如果你使用的是自定义代币、跨链映射地址,或者钱包对某些链的派生路径处理不同,可能导致生成的地址与预期公钥对应关系不一致。对用户来说表现为“转账界面正常,但链上就是不接受”。这时最有效的做法不是反复点击重试,而是回到源头:核对链ID、代币合约地址、接收地址网络前缀是否一致,并在必要时用小额做验证。

当你把排查按“签名验证→手续费与节点响应→稳定币合约执行→链上事件追踪→公钥/地址体系核对”的顺序走一遍,就会发现所谓“转不出钱”,很多时候并不是系统故障,而是多个环节的规则互相咬合后形成的卡点。你越早完成定位,越能避免在错误路径上反复试错,把风险留给那些真正需要关注的市场动向与支付创新,而不是消耗在无意义的重发之上。

作者:林澈发布时间:2026-05-17 12:19:16

评论

MingWei_17

按“签名验证→合约执行→手续费/节点”这种顺序排,基本不会被界面误导。

小鹿遇见星光

稳定币这块确实容易踩链不一致的坑,建议务必核对代币合约地址。

CipherBloom

智能资产追踪的思路很实用:别只看钱包余额,要看链上事件有没有落地。

NovaZhang

公钥/地址体系那段提醒到我了,以前只看地址没核对链ID。

Aether中文

文章逻辑很严谨,尤其“高峰期手续费导致超时”的部分,很像我遇到的情况。

相关阅读